Subject: Per-tenant rate quota cut-over — summary for plugin authors

Hello plugin authors — the Quenfield gateway completed its cut-over to per-tenant rate quotas last night. Global limits are gone; each tenant now carries its own request budget, and plugin traffic counts against the tenant that invoked it. Burst allowances were tuned during the overlap window, and no tenant hit a hard cap after hour two. Please update your retry logic to honor the new quota headers. The gateway now enforces the following configuration.

settings of kagag-kagef:
[kelath]
port = 9300
region = west-4
host = kelath.olvarqworks.example
team = sorion
timeout_ms = 1000
retries = 8

The Dunmarrow resize CLI works, but the tuning story is fragile. Magic numbers are scattered across three modules; consolidate them or the next maintainer will miss one. Also, the thread pool default assumes SSD-backed temp storage — note that in the help text. Retry backoff on partial writes looks correct. Please move everything into a single constants block so changes are auditable in one diff. For the record, current effective values follow.

limits module of tafop-hahop:
WEIGHTS = {
    "julmir": 223,
    "belox": 987,
    "lamion": 470,
    "pelath": 609,
    "fraok": 1010,
    "eliion": 343,
    "drudor": 342,
}

Leadership Review Briefing — FX Hedging

Quick recap for Thursday: Vermilla Goods now books roughly a third of revenue in krontal-denominated contracts, and the swings last quarter stung. Treasury recommends locking in forward cover for 60% of expected exposure through year-end rather than staying spot. Cost is modest, sleep is better. Marta from Treasury will walk through the numbers. The confidential note on related plans follows below.

management briefing: Only 3 of the 140 pilot accounts renewed Oliix, so a churn review is set for July 1.

## Changelog — 3.8.2: Signing Key Rotation

Rotated the signing identity used for the Lumenseek relevance tuning notes bundle after the scheduled quarterly window. All bundles published from this release onward are signed with the new identity; older signatures remain valid for verification until end of quarter. The new public key follows.

release key, hadug-kawef: bky13_mPGeFZeR1GZ1G